What are the differences between Lavida and Gran Lavida?

6Answers
SanVivienne
08/30/2025, 12:02:25 AM

The differences between Lavida and Gran Lavida are: 1. Different body structures: Lavida is a four-door sedan; Gran Lavida is a five-door hatchback. 2. Different body dimensions: Lavida measures 4670mm in length, 1806mm in width, and 1474m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2688mm; Gran Lavida measures 4445mm in length, 1765mm in width, and 1485m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2610mm. Both Lavida and Gran Lavida are compact cars under SAIC Volkswagen, equipped with naturally aspirated engines, featuring MacPherson independent front suspension and torsion beam non-independent rear suspension.

What Causes the BMW Engine Hood to Overheat?

BMW engine hood overheating may be caused by excessive dirt on the radiator surface, thermostat failure, or prolonged lack of coolant replacement. Solutions for thermostat failure: After starting the engine, check for water flow in the cooling tank; inspect whether there is water flow at the radiator inlet pipe; observe the temperature gauge to see if it shows any abnormalities. Solutions for excessive dirt on the radiator surface: Radiator blockages can be internal or external. When cleaning, pay attention to the types of debris on the radiator surface. For dry leaves, mud, etc., you can first use a brush to slowly clean, removing larger debris before using a high-pressure water gun for washing. When using the high-pressure water gun, adjust the nozzle to a spray pattern and avoid angling it towards the radiator fins, as this can easily bend the fins and affect performance. If there is a lot of willow catkins or similar debris on the radiator, avoid using water for cleaning. Fluffy materials like willow catkins stick to the fins when wet, making them hard to remove and impairing heat dissipation. It's best to use a brush to clean them bit by bit, then remove the radiator and use high-pressure air to blow from the inside out.

BMW X5 Engine Oil at 98°C, What is the Coolant Temperature?

BMW X5 engine oil at 98°C, the coolant temperature should be 90°C. Hazards of Abnormal Engine Coolant Temperature: When the engine coolant temperature is too low, the combustion of gases inside the engine becomes incomplete, and it also affects the lubrication effect of the antifreeze. Of course, the vehicle's tailpipe emissions will exceed standards. When the temperature is too high, it can easily cause boiling, leading to excessive engine temperature, which can damage the engine. Standard Settings for Engine Coolant Temperature: The normal coolant temperature for BMW engines ranges between 80°C and 120°C. The engine control unit can adjust the engine temperature according to driving conditions. It can achieve four different temperature adjustment ranges: 112°C for economy mode, 105°C for normal mode, 95°C for sport mode, and 80°C for maximum power mode.

What type of suspension does the Skoda Superb use?

Skoda Superb uses a MacPherson strut independent suspension at the front and a four-link independent suspension at the rear. Advantages of Skoda Superb's suspension system: The Superb is based on Volkswagen's PQ46 platform, featuring a MacPherson strut independent front suspension and a four-link independent rear suspension. The robust lower control arm not only withstands significant forces but also effectively protects other suspension components from damage in case of chassis impact. Additionally, the suspension is relatively soft, providing enhanced comfort. What are the reasons why the trunk of a BMW 320 won't pop up?

The reasons why the trunk of a BMW 320 won't pop up are insufficient spring tension, which prevents it from opening; or lock mechanism displacement or lack of lubrication causing the unlocking process to be stuck. Solutions for insufficient spring tension: First, open the trunk. At the corners of the trunk, peel back the rubber strip by hand and remove the interior trim panel to reveal the opening tension spring. For new cars, the normal setting is in the first position. If the trunk lid's opening and closing force is insufficient, it can be adjusted to the second or third position as needed. If the hydraulic struts of the trunk have lost their tension, it is best to take the car to a repair shop or a 4S store for servicing. How many lights are on when the Corolla is reversing?

When the Corolla is reversing, both the left and right lights should be on. Introduction to car reverse lights: Car reverse lights are installed at the rear of the vehicle and are used to illuminate the road behind when reversing, as well as to alert vehicles and pedestrians behind. Material description of car reverse lights: Gas car reverse lights, which use halogen materials. Halogen reverse lights are mature in technology and low in price, and are used in many vehicle models. However, they also have some drawbacks, such as radiation, mercury content, and being prone to breakage, which brings certain inconveniences to transportation and installation. The service life is about 8,000 hours. LED car reverse lights, which use LED materials. LED reverse lights are pollution-free, radiation-free, and have a long service life, with a theoretical lifespan of over 50,000 hours. Many vehicle models have already modified their reverse lights to LED reverse lights. However, due to their higher price, LED reverse lights have a significant impact on widespread use. Especially in China, the penetration rate is quite low, while in developed countries, the penetration rate is quite high.

Is New Baojun a Joint Venture Car?

New Baojun is not considered a joint venture car; it belongs to domestic vehicles. Introduction to Joint Venture Cars: As the name suggests, joint venture cars are projects jointly established by Chinese and foreign investors. The Chinese side contributes by providing land and factory usage rights, as well as capital, while the foreign investors contribute brands, technology, capital, and talent. Joint venture cars are the products of such collaborations. The foreign party provides technology, talent, and brands for assembly within the country, but the core technology remains under foreign control. Advantages of Joint Venture Cars: Strong brand reputation and competitiveness. Joint venture cars have a long history of development, strong brand recognition, and high competitiveness. Better quality. Domestic cars started late and developed slowly, only recently catching up, but they still lag far behind joint venture cars in terms of engine technology. Joint venture cars have better quality, with mature R&D technology and more experience accumulated over years of development. Higher resale value. Joint venture cars have a broader market due to their better quality and stronger brand recognition, making even used cars more popular in the market. Many consumers prefer buying used joint venture cars over used domestic cars, resulting in higher resale value for joint venture cars.
